Choosing the Right Skylight
Selecting the best skylight is a critical action in improving both the functional and visual elements of your room. Northeast Ohio Roofing Contractors. The choice process involves numerous important aspects, including the kind, size, and material of the skylight, as well as its power performance rankings
There are different kinds of skylights readily available, such as repaired, aired vent, and tubular skylights, each offering different objectives. Repaired skylights are ideal for all-natural lighting, while vented choices enable airflow, contributing to far better interior air quality. Tubular skylights are specifically efficient in smaller sized rooms, transporting light from the roofing system down right into the inside.
The dimension of the skylight should be proportional to the room and its existing frameworks, guaranteeing an ideal equilibrium of light without frustrating the area. Additionally, take into consideration the product and glazing options. Double-glazed or low-E glass can significantly enhance thermal performance and minimize energy expenses by decreasing heat loss during colder months.
Preparing Your Roof Covering Framework
Prior to installment, it's vital to make certain that your roof framework is sufficiently prepared to support the new skylight. Begin by evaluating the existing roof covering framing to confirm it fulfills the lots requirements for the skylight you have actually chosen. Depending upon the dimension and layout, extra support may be necessary to avoid structural failing.
Following, examine the roof material and underlying elements for any type of indications of damage or degeneration. Any kind of endangered areas ought to be repaired or replaced to ensure a stable structure for the skylight installation. Additionally, consider the pitch of your roof covering; a steeper incline might call for certain flashing techniques to stop leakages.
Guarantee that the area bordering the setup website is free from debris and challenges to promote a secure and effective installment process. It is suggested to have a specialist examine your roofing system's architectural stability, particularly if you doubt regarding its condition or tons capacity. Lastly, inspect regional building ordinance and guidelines to ensure conformity with any kind of demands associated with skylight setups, as this can affect both safety and security and power efficiency. Appropriate prep work will improve the longevity and performance of your skylight, maximizing its energy-saving potential.
Setup Techniques for Skylights
Effective setup strategies for skylights are crucial to ensuring their proper performance and durability (Cleveland Heights Roof Maintenance). Initially, it is important to choose the proper location for the skylight, thinking about factors such as roofing pitch, sunshine exposure, and prospective blockages. As soon as the place is identified, cautious dimensions must be required to create an accurate opening in the roof
Prior to cutting, make sure the roofing system structure can sustain the skylight's weight. Utilize a power saw to reduce the roofing opening, making sure the edges are smooth and totally free from splinters. Next off, set up a curb or framework around the open up to provide a solid base for the skylight and to promote proper water drainage.
When placing the skylight, straighten it with the visual and secure it utilizing suitable fasteners. It's essential to adhere to the manufacturer's standards relating to the spacing and kind of bolts used. After securing the skylight, check for degree and plumb placement.

Maintenance Tips for Energy Performance
Sustaining power effectiveness in your skylight calls for a proactive technique to upkeep that addresses both efficiency and longevity. Routine examinations are essential; check for indications of water condensation, leakage, or mold and mildew. Pay unique interest to the seals and flashing, as these areas are essential for stopping drafts and wetness breach.
Cleaning the glass surface area is equally vital; dirt and debris can substantially lower all-natural light transmission, thereby affecting your home's power efficiency. Make use of a mild, non-abrasive cleaner to prevent harming the surface. Furthermore, cleanse the inside and check and exterior components, such as the framework and any type of operable parts, to ensure smooth performance.
Take into consideration seasonal maintenance checks, specifically after extreme weather, to identify any prospective problems prior to they rise. Ensure that the skylight is adequately insulated and that the surrounding roofing location remains in excellent problem.
Lastly, if your skylight includes operable ventilation, ensure that the systems are working correctly to promote airflow and minimize indoor humidity degrees. Routine maintenance not only boosts energy effectiveness however likewise expands the life of your skylight, providing lasting value to my explanation your home.
